Horizontal curves
Definition
Horizontal, circular or simple
curves are curves of constant
radius required to connect
two straights set out on the
ground.

Usage
roads, railways, kerb lines,
pipe lines and may be set out
in several ways, depending on
their length and radius.

Circular curves may be set out in a variety of
required, its radius of curvature and obstructions on site.
OUT
Methods of setting out are as follows:
•Using one theodolite and a tape by the tangent angle method. This method
can be used on all curves, but is necessary for long curves of radius unless
they are set out by coordinates.
•Using two theodolites. This method can be used on smaller curves where the
whole length is visible from both tangent points and where two instruments are
available.
•Using tapes only by the method of offsets from the tangent. This method is
used for minor curves only.
•Using tapes only by the method of offsets from the long chord. This method is
used for short radius curves.

OPTICAL SQUARE
Optical squares are simple sighting instruments
used to set out right angles. They can be
provided either with mirrors or with one or two
prisms. Because of practical difficulties in using
squares with mirrors, they have been replaced
by squares with prisms: "prismatic squares".
There are two major types of prismatic squares:
single prismatic squares and double prismatic
squares; both will be dealt with in the sections
which follow.
